Alex Trebek dies at 80.

Post by radioandtventhusiast » Sun Nov 08, 2020 1:25 pm

Alex Trebek died this morning after his courageous battle with pancreatic cancer. He's hosted Jeopardy since 1984. He was one of the greats to host any game show and will be very much missed. May he R.I.P.

Post by Calvert DeForest » Sun Nov 29, 2020 2:22 pm

Alex's final week is now scheduled to air January 4th-8th. Best of Jeopardy episodes featuring the most memorable shows of the Trebek era will air the weeks of December 21st and 28th. Ken Jennings will begin his stint as interim host Monday, January 11th. Not sure how long his initial run will be, but there will be a rotation of fill-in hosts for the time being.
